The end of June is restaurant week in NYC when many of New York's best restaurants offer a 3 course prix fixe dinner menu for $30.03. I'm sure you will get plenty of great suggestions on this site. Once you do, visit www.visitnyc.com and click on "Restaurant Week" to see if any of the suggestions are a participating restaurant. You can even make reservations on the website. This is really a great bargain - you can experience a great NY restaurant and stay well within your budget.
